Skip to main content
Répondu

Compteur RCO - Comment ne pas afficher commentaire sur bulletin ?


Chrystelle
Agent Silae
Forum|alt.badge.img+3

Bonjour,

Sur plusieurs dossiers, un client souhaite supprimer l’affiche du commentaire du compteur RCO sur le bulletin après avoir saisi le nombre d’heures via le profil RCOacquis. Comment faire ?

Demande urgente et importante car sujet avec l’inspection du travail, le commentaire ne doit vraiment pas apparaître.

Profil :

affichage sur bulletin à supprimer : 

 



Je n’ai pas trouvé de méthodes sauf erreur de ma part.



Merci d’avance

@Anthony Petit 

Meilleure réponse par Anthony Petit

Bonjour ​@Chrystelle

Vous pouvez créer une fonction calcul :

INIT-RCOACQUIS

call MessageRCOHeuresAcquisesActif(false)

9 commentaires

Anthony Petit
Community Manager
Forum|alt.badge.img+5
  • Community Manager
  • Réponse
  • October 2, 2025

Bonjour ​@Chrystelle

Vous pouvez créer une fonction calcul :

INIT-RCOACQUIS

call MessageRCOHeuresAcquisesActif(false)


Chrystelle
Agent Silae
Forum|alt.badge.img+3
  • Auteur
  • Agent Silae
  • October 2, 2025

Bonjour ​@Chrystelle

Vous pouvez créer une fonction calcul :

INIT-RCOACQUIS

call MessageRCOHeuresAcquisesActif(false)

Mille mercis Anthony c’est super !! Très bonne journée


Anthony Petit
Community Manager
Forum|alt.badge.img+5
  • Community Manager
  • October 2, 2025

Je vous en prie avec plaisir ! :)


Forum|alt.badge.img+2
  • Expert
  • November 5, 2025

Bonjour je rebondis sur cette demande j’ai besoin de la même chose pour les RCC et RCR, je crée la fonction calcul

INIT-RCCACQUIS

call MessageRCCHeuresAcquisesActif(false)
 

Mais j’ai toujours l’affichage sur le bulletin

 

Merci pour vos réponses

Ozlem


Forum|alt.badge.img+2
  • Expert
  • November 5, 2025

Petit précision, j’ai créer un profil de prime pour pouvoir saisir l’acquis et personnalisé le libellé et paramétrer le paiement en cas de sortie

//
Begin


RCR = BUL.RCCHeuresAcquises 

RCC = Saisie("Heures JF1",0)
If RCC<> 0 then 
//    ce qui permet d'incrémenter le compteur et mettre une ligne sur le bulletin
    Call AjouteRCCHeuresAcquises(RCC)
    Exec("Lprime_D02")
//    LigneNeutre = True
    methodeCalcul = 99
    Bases = RCC

    Liblong = "Heures JF"
    Exec ("GenereLprime")
    LigneNeutre = False
EndIf
//-----------Paiement indemnité compensatrice RCC- Compteur JF---------------

if bul.sorticemois then
soldeRCC = RCR - BUL.RCCHeuresPrises 
RCC = Saisie("SoldeRCC",0)
If RCC <> 0 then soldeRCC = RCC
If RCC = -1 then soldeRCC = 0

If soldeRCC <> 0 then
    Exec("Lprime_I12")
    methodeCalcul = 3
    Tauxs = Bul.TauxHoraire
    Bases = soldeRCC
    Liblong ="Indemnité compensatrice des Heures JF"
    Call AjouteRCRHeuresPrises(soldeRCC)
    Exec ("GenereLprime")
EndIf

    endif
End


Forum|alt.badge.img+2
  • Expert
  • November 5, 2025

Finalement j’ai trouvé j’ai fait cela

//La ligne avec le code suivant call MessageRCRHeuresAcquisesActif(false) permet de ne pas afficher le commentaire de Silae acquis RCC sur le bulletin
//La ligne avec le code LigneNeutre = True permet d'imprimer le libellé Heures récup en neutre grisé

Begin


RCR = BUL.RCRHeuresAcquises 

RCR = Saisie("Heures RECUP",0)
If RCR<> 0 then 
//    ce qui permet d'incrémenter le compteur et mettre une ligne sur le bulletin
    Call AjouteRCRHeuresAcquises(RCR)
call MessageRCRHeuresAcquisesActif(false)

    Exec("Lprime_D02")
    LigneNeutre = True
    methodeCalcul = 99
    Bases = RCR

    Liblong = "Heures recup"
    Exec ("GenereLprime")
//    LigneNeutre = False

EndIf
//-----------Paiement indemnité compensatrice RCR---------------

if bul.sorticemois then
soldeRCR = RCR - BUL.RCRHeuresPrises 
RCR = Saisie("SoldeRCR",0)
If RCR <> 0 then soldeRCR = RCR
If RCR = -1 then soldeRCR = 0

If soldeRCR <> 0 then
    Exec("Lprime_I12")
    methodeCalcul = 3
    Tauxs = Bul.TauxHoraire
    Bases = soldeRCR
    Liblong ="Indemnité compensatrice des Heures de récupération"
    Call AjouteRCRHeuresPrises(soldeRCR)
    Exec ("GenereLprime")
EndIf

    endif
End
Begin


RCR = BUL.RCRHeuresAcquises 

RCR = Saisie("Heures RECUP",0)
If RCR<> 0 then 
//    ce qui permet d'incrémenter le compteur et mettre une ligne sur le bulletin
    Call AjouteRCRHeuresAcquises(RCR)
call MessageRCRHeuresAcquisesActif(false)

    Exec("Lprime_D02")
    LigneNeutre = True
    methodeCalcul = 99
    Bases = RCR

    Liblong = "Heures recup"
    Exec ("GenereLprime")
//    LigneNeutre = False

EndIf
//-----------Paiement indemnité compensatrice RCR---------------

if bul.sorticemois then
soldeRCR = RCR - BUL.RCRHeuresPrises 
RCR = Saisie("SoldeRCR",0)
If RCR <> 0 then soldeRCR = RCR
If RCR = -1 then soldeRCR = 0

If soldeRCR <> 0 then
    Exec("Lprime_I12")
    methodeCalcul = 3
    Tauxs = Bul.TauxHoraire
    Bases = soldeRCR
    Liblong ="Indemnité compensatrice des Heures de récupération"
    Call AjouteRCRHeuresPrises(soldeRCR)
    Exec ("GenereLprime")
EndIf

    endif
End


Anthony Petit
Community Manager
Forum|alt.badge.img+5
  • Community Manager
  • November 5, 2025

Bonjour,

Vous êtes allé plus vite que moi pour la réponse ! je vous aurais également proposé de mettre en commentaire les lignes :)


Forum|alt.badge.img+2

 

 

Bonjour,

Vous êtes allé plus vite que moi pour la réponse ! je vous aurais également proposé de mettre en commentaire les lignes :)

Bonjour,

Pourriez-vous m’aider à paramétrer la neutralisation de l’affichage du RCR.

J’ai tenté plusieurs choses, rien ne fonctionne. Merci beaucoup.

Soit neutraliser la HS00RR ou commentaire RCR car actuellement la mention fait doublon.

 

 

 


Anthony Petit
Community Manager
Forum|alt.badge.img+5
  • Community Manager
  • March 27, 2026

Bonjour,

Les HS00RR génèrent cette ligne de repos compensateur par défaut.

Il n’est pas possible de ne pas afficher l’un et l’autre car ce sont les heures qui appellent les RCR.

il n’est pas possible de masque l’acquisition sur le bulletin, comme c’est le cas pour l’ajout de RCR par le biais du profil, car les RC sont appelées via les heures et non pas par le profil.